Abstract

The invention belongs to educational management field, specifically discloses a kind of Intelligent campus information-pushing method, comprises the following steps:S1:Preconfigured student's Basic Information Table is sent to the server being connected with management terminal signal by management terminal;S2:The information on student's essential information extraction module extraction student's Basic Information Table in management terminal is as the key character for generating login account and password respectively;S3:Account generation module in management terminal generates corresponding student login account and password and the account of generation and password are formed account number cipher statistical form according to key character symbol to be sent to server;S4:Account and password statistical form are downloaded by the user terminal being connected with server signal.Compared with prior art, this base case realizes automatically generating for account and password, effectively reduces workload and the working time of manager.

Technical field
The invention belongs to educational management field, specifically discloses a kind of Intelligent campus information-pushing method.
Background technology
Existing school can all have an information intercourse platform to be opened for student and school teacher, and student or teacher can lead to Crossing terminal and log into this platform, teacher can issue some information in this platform or data is checked for student, and for The student newly to enter a school, the account that they do not log in, so needing manager oneself to distribute account or student oneself registration account Number.
If student oneself register account number, school's register account number on this platform of the people beyond school in order to prevent, increase Back-stage management is born, and generally can all allow the student of register account number to fill in some checking informations, such as:ID card No., phone number The essential informations such as code, name, class, student number, new life are registered according to relevant operating instruction.And the student newly to enter a school is to learning Number, the information such as class be not all familiar with also, voluntarily register the time length of cost.
If school manager voluntarily distributes account, since the student's quantity being related to is more so that manager's account shares out the work Amount is big.
In view of the above-mentioned problems, a kind of Intelligent campus information management system is applicant provided, now for this Intelligent campus Information management system proposes a kind of Intelligent campus information-pushing method.
The content of the invention
Present invention aims at a kind of Intelligent campus information-pushing method is provided, to solve student registration account in the prior art Number or school manager distribution account it is time-consuming and laborious the problem of.
In order to achieve the above object, base case of the invention is:Intelligent campus information-pushing method, including following step Suddenly:
S1:Preconfigured student's Basic Information Table is sent to the service being connected with management terminal signal by management terminal Device;
S2:The information on student's essential information extraction module extraction student's Basic Information Table in management terminal is as difference Generate the key character of login account and password;
S3:Account generation module in management terminal generates corresponding student login account and password according to key character symbol And the account of generation and password are formed into account number cipher statistical form and sent to server;
S4:Account and password statistical form are downloaded by the user terminal being connected with server signal.
The operation principle of this base case is:The admission information of student generally comprises name, student number, ID card No. Deng manager by the essential information editor of student or can be uploaded in management terminal by student's essential information recording module;It Student's essential information extraction module extracts information as the account for generating the student login accordingly on student's Basic Information Table afterwards Number and password, and the account of generation and password are formed into account number cipher statistical form, school manager can pass through account generation module Account number cipher statistical form is downloaded.
The beneficial effect of this base case is:The login account and password of student, nothing are generated by account generation module Administrative staff's manual allocation is needed, reduces the workload of administrative staff;Meanwhile voluntarily registered without student, save student's Time;In addition, account produces Module Generation account, outside school personnel just cannot voluntarily register account number, reduce information interchange Platform final-period management is born, meanwhile, the exclusive resource of school will not be leaked out because logging in personnel's registration outside school;Student believes Breath extraction module is extracted automatically for the information in student's Basic Information Table, avoids manually extraction information and mistake occurs Phenomenon;
Compared with prior art, this base case realizes automatically generating for account and password, effectively reduces manager Workload and the working time.
